Output 32c690ef80084967ccca7317b26745d5dd5db8525297e3a17a596934c9a0b489:1

value
2689950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ee6ac81265b82de41d23ccd054ff8e97c4438b3 OP_EQUALVERIFY OP_CHECKSIG
address
18CC3Tq2DfN1z7a8cex9RKhj2rSEiZ31vV
transaction
32c690ef80084967ccca7317b26745d5dd5db8525297e3a17a596934c9a0b489
spent
true